about

Phil Coyne and The Wayward Aces' follow up release to "Sound and Fury" rockets along like a hi octane blues fueled jet fighter.

While Sound and Fury was fully immersed in Blues, the new release "Phil Coyne and The Wayward Aces" goes adventuring into new territory - from Chicago blues to early 60's rock and roll, garage surf and rockabilly.

Recorded on one track tape quarter inch tape at Quasar Studio over two dates in 2023, the album was recorded in one room a la “Sound and Fury”. Maestro Sam Valentino recorded, mixed and mastered the album.

Originals were penned by Phil Coyne with Oscar LaDell and Will Harris’ contributing to feel, melody, drive and vibe.
